  • the present invention relates to a bracket for the straightening of bodies or other damaged parts of motor vehicles. It also targets installations commonly known as “marbles” and permanently fitted with this straightening bracket.
  • a straightening bracket (DE-A-2 739 528) mainly comprising a horizontal articulated beam provided with wheels and equipped with fixing flanges allowing its anchoring on the marble after positioning below it, and an articulated arm comprising an upper portion that can be tilted 45 degrees, to the right and to the left, this arm being mounted with a capacity for pivoting forwards and backwards, at one of the ends of said horizontal beam, and connected to the latter by means of a jack.
  • the disadvantages of this device include: - a reduced radius of action, resulting from the fact that it can only work in a limited range of directions; - to require numerous changes of anchoring location on the marble, requiring great efforts (the apparatus being very heavy and bulky) and entailing considerable loss of time; - not being able to be positioned precisely in the pulling axis or desirable thrust, in particular due to the presence of clamps and fittings for fixing the car, equipping the long sides of the marbles. - to require a large and clear field of action around the work plan, because of its length and its weight which require its mounting on wheels; - occupy a large storage space, outside periods of use.
  • This device has the drawbacks of the device described above, although it is a little less bulky than the latter. However, it has the additional disadvantage that it can only be used with special benches and that it cannot be combined with traditional marbles.
  • the object of the present invention is in particular to remedy the various aforementioned drawbacks of known straightening brackets.
  • this objective is achieved by means of a straightening bracket comprising a beam mounted with a pivoting ability about a vertical axis, by means of one of its end portions, and on the opposite end part. from which is mounted a pivoting arm connected to said beam by through a jack,
  • this straightening bracket being mainly remarkable in that it comprises a positioning hoop in the form of a circular arc having, preferably, a length of the order of 180 degrees and arranged around of said vertical pivot axis of the beam which is equipped with a locking means making it possible to lock it on any point of said hoop, so as to be able to immobilize it in any position relative to the longitudinal axis of the marble at one end of which said straightening bracket can be removably installed or permanently mounted.
  • the pivoting beam is executed, in a manner known per se, in two parts assembled by means of a joint comprising a vertical axis.
  • the pivoting arm is mounted, in a manner known per se, with a tilting ability, to the right and to the left, around the axis of the portion of the beam on which it is installed, or around an axis parallel to said portion.
  • the straightening bracket according to the invention provides several important advantages: - it has a large radius of action allowing it to work with precision, from its only two mounting locations, in all desirable directions; - it requires infrequent mounting location changes; if we consider that damaged vehicles are damaged only in their front part or only in their rear part, it most often makes it possible to straighten all the sheets or other deformed parts of these vehicles without changing mounting location; - It can remain in place at one end of the marble while being ready for use, that is to say without obligation to change the mounting location; - it requires a small field of action around the worktop, due to the fact that its changes of mounting location are infrequent and that it can be transported easily from one end to the other of the marble, due to its reduced weight and size; - to be able to be permanently installed at one end or at each end of the marble.
  • the straightening bracket according to the invention greatly facilitates the straightening operations of crumpled sheets or other damaged parts of vehicles, by very significantly reducing the time of these operations and the fatigue which results therefrom.
  • This comprises a beam 1 usually called “horizontal beam” and which, in a manner known per se, is advantageously executed in two parts 2 and 3 assembled by means of an articulation comprising a vertical axis 4.
  • One of the ends of the beam element 3 is provided with a bell-shaped yoke 5 rigidly secured to said end.
  • This bell has sector-shaped upper and lower walls whose diverging edges are joined by side walls.
  • One of the ends of the second beam element 2 is housed in this bell to which it is subject by means of the vertical articulation axis 4, for example constituted by a bolt, the rod of which passes through vertically aligned holes presented by said end and said bell.
  • the beam element 3 can thus pivot on an angle delimited by the side walls of the bell 5 and which can be, for example, 120 degrees; said element 3 thus being able to occupy different angular positions with respect to the beam element 2.
  • the immobilization of the beam element 3 in any angular position relative to the beam element 2 is for example obtained by means of a locking device comprising a flange 6 and a clamping screw 7 whose rod passes through on the one hand, holes with a vertical axis formed in the extreme portion of the beam element 3 at a distance from the holes allowing the passage of the axis 4 and, on the other hand, arched slots 8 with notched edges that have the upper and lower walls of the bell 5, concentrically with their through hole of said axis.
  • a nut 7a screwing onto the threaded upper portion of the screw 7 allows, by means of a locking piece 7b with notched lower edges cooperating with the notched edges of the upper arched lumen 8, to immobilize the element of beam 3 in the desired position.
  • pivoting arm 9 On the extreme portion of the beam element 3 opposite the end provided with the bell 5, is mounted the pivoting arm 9 for pulling and pushing the straightening bracket, generally called “vertical arm”.
  • This arm is fixed to said end portion by means of an axis 10 allowing its inclination towards forward or backward.
  • the vertical arm 10 is mounted, in a manner known per se, with a tilting ability, to the right or to the left, around the axis of the portion of the horizontal beam 1 on which it is installed or around an axis parallel to said portion, for example on an arc of a circle of the order of 180 degrees.
  • the lower end of the vertical arm 9 is subject, by means of the hinge pin 10, to a yoke 11 rigidly secured to a cylindrical sleeve 3a mounted with an aptitude for rotation around a inner tube 3b, one end of which is rigidly attached to the bell 5; the assembly: cylindrical sleeve 3a, inner tube 3b and bell 5 constituting the element 3 of the horizontal beam 1.
  • the immobilization of the vertical arm in the desired position is obtained by means of a pin or pin 12 engaging in diametrically opposite holes presented by the rotary sleeve 3a and the inner tube 3b.
  • the latter comprises, for example, two holes aligned vertically, while the rotary sleeve has a plurality of holes 13 distributed over its periphery and diametrically opposite, two by two.
  • the chain anchor clevis 14 allowing the chain to be fixed when the bracket is working in draft (which is the most common case) or the pusher member fixing clevis (when the bracket is working in pushing) , is mounted in an adjustable way along the vertical arm.
  • This yoke is, for example, mounted with a sliding ability on the vertical arm and, its immobilization in the desirable position is obtained by means of a screw 15 screwed into a nut 15a integral with the collar 14a sliding from said yoke and taking support, by through its internal end, against a face of said arm.
  • the latter is connected to the horizontal beam 1 by means of a jack 16.
  • this jack is secured, by means of its ends and by means of articulations 17, 18, on the one hand, in a yoke 19 secured to the arm 9 and, from on the other hand, in a yoke 20 integral with the sleeve 3b.
  • the yoke 20 also carries a pulley 21 for returning the chain, the support of which is mounted with a tilting ability, on the said yoke.
  • the horizontal beam 1, and more precisely according to the example illustrated, the element 2 of the latter, is fixed to a rigid crosspiece 22 with a possibility of pivoting about a vertical axis.
  • This cross member for example executed using a robust tube of quadrangular section: - is independent of the marble, when the straightening square is intended to be installed, in a removable manner, at one or the other of the ends of traditional marbles; - But it can also be constituted by the short sides of marbles permanently fitted with straightening brackets according to the invention during their manufacture.
  • the crosspiece 22 can be advantageously mounted on wheels 23 arranged below its ends, as shown in Figure 4. It can also be mounted on feet fitted said ends.
  • the articulated connection of the beam 1 on the crosspiece 22 is obtained by means of a vertical axis 24 and a yoke 25 which is provided with said crosspiece in the middle, and between the cheeks of which is housed the end of said beam.
  • the straightening bracket also comprises a positioning arch 26 having the shape of an arc of a circle and disposed around the axis 24 of pivoting of the horizontal beam placed at the center of the circular arc formed by said arch which has a diameter D of greater length than the width L of the frame of the marble 32 on which said straightening bracket is mounted or called to be installed.
  • This arch can be constituted by a robust metal profile suitably bent and it advantageously has a length of 180 degrees and, for example, a radius of 800 mm.
  • the semi-circular arch 26 thus shaped is rigidly secured to the crosspiece 22 to which it is attached by means of its ends which are, for example, fixed by welding to said crosspiece which therefore has a length corresponding substantially to the diameter D of said arch, that is to say a length greater than the width L of the frame of the marble 32.
  • the pivoting beam 1 is placed below the positioning arch 26 and its part 2 is provided with a locking means 27 making it possible to immobilize it on any point of said arch.
  • This locking means comprises, for example, a flange 28 (FIG. 8) provided with a hole 29 for the passage of the rod of a connecting member such as a stud 30 carried by the upper face of the element of beam 2.
  • a nut 31 screwing onto the threaded upper portion of said stud and bearing on the upper face of the flange, allows the positioning hoop 26 to be tightened between said flange and said beam element.
  • the straightening square according to the invention is also equipped with assembly means making it possible to fix it securely on marble 32.
  • flanges 33 provided with a hole 34 for the passage of the rod of connecting members such as studs 35 carried by the upper face of the crosspiece 22; a nut 36 screwing onto the threaded upper portion of said stud and bearing on the upper face of the flange, allows the lateral wing 32a of the side members 32b of the plate 32 to be clamped between said flange and said crosspiece;
  • FIG. 11 illustrates a plate 32 (shown in fine lines), each end of which is equipped with a straightening square produced in the manner which has just been described. Such an installation allows work in all directions, without having to move the straightening brackets.
  • the marbles can be permanently fitted with such straightening brackets, the crosspieces of which can, in this case, be constituted by a fixed element of the rectangular frame of the marble, as indicated above.

Abstract

The draw-straightening arm comprising a beam (1) called "horizontal beam" mounted with an ability to pivot about a vertical axis (24), by way of one of its end portions, and on the end portion opposite which is mounted a pivoting arm called "vertical arm" (9) connected to the said beam by way of a cylinder (16), characterised in that it comprises a positioning hoop (26) in the shape of an arc of a circle having a diameter (D) of size greater than the width (L) of the surface plate (32) on which the said draw-straightening arm is mounted or intended to be installed, this positioning hoop (26) preferably having a length of the order of 180 degrees and being arranged around the said pivoting axis of the beam which is equipped with a locking means (27) enabling it to be locked on any point of the hoop. <IMAGE>
